Jason Marczak Submits Comments on NAFTA Negotiations to the Office of the United States Trade Representative

By Adrienne Arsht Latin America Center

Jason Marczak, Director, Latin America Economic Growth Initiative Adrienne Arsht Latin America Center, Atlantic Council, submitted comments on NAFTA negotiations to the Office of United States Trade Representative (USTR) on June 12, 2017. His comment outlined negotiating objectives of the North America free trade agreement with Canada and Mexico. USTR requested comments from the public […]
